at Sutton Coldfield Quaker Meeting House, Sutton ColdfieldCome to a Quaker “craftivist” workshop – and what’s more Quaker than a tapestry?! Produce a mini-banner, using cross- stitch, appliqué, fabric pens, or any other method, we can illustrate the impact of the arms trade and our resistance to it on a small piece of fabric.
The mini-banners will be joined together at the protest against the DSEI arms fair in September to form a big tapestry. After the action they will be used around London to highlight DSEI and the impact of the international arms trade.
